Central European bone Selenus type chess pieces, late 19th century
One side stained red and the opposing natural with the embellishments to each side highlighted, the kings and queens with open crowns, above serrated and pierced crows nest galleries, the bishops with urn shaped finials, the rooks with open conical domes below crescent moon finials, some minor chips and looses overall -- King 43/8in. (11cm.) high, pawn 1¾in. (4.5cm.) high (32)

COMPARATIVE LITERATURE
VICTOR KEATS, THE ILLUSTRATED GUIDE TO THE WORLD OF CHESS SETS, BATSFORD LTD, 1985. A SIMILAR SET IS ILLUSTRATED IN FIG. 79, PAGE 72. THE SET IS DANISH AND DERIVED FROM THE SELENUS DESIGN.
